SINGAPORE STRAIT.
Singapore. Fort Canning.-The Candle Power of this light has been increased from 9,000 to 20,000 from May 16th, 1914.
Norsburgh (Pedra Branca).—The Candle Power of this light will be increased from 22,500 to 103,000. The duration of flash will be altered to 14". Probable date on or about May 30th, 1914.
MALACCA STRAIT.
Pulo Pisang.-The Candle Power of this light will be increased from 22,000 to 103,000. The duration of flash will be altered to ". Probable date, June 1914.
Pulo Undan.-The Candle Power of this light will be increased from 9,500 to 35,000. Probable date, June 1914.
Muka Head (Penang).-The Candle Power of this light will be increased from 45,000 to 206,000. The duration of flash will be altered to 11". Probable date, July 1914.

CANTON DISTRICT.
LOCAL NOTICE TO MARINERS No. 106.
Canton River :
Sunken Steam Launch Off First Bar Island ; Wreck Marked by Native Boat.
NOTICE is hereby given that the Steam Launch Yuen Fat lies sunk in 21 feet at L. W. S. T. in the fairway abreast First Bar Light Station. From the position of the Wreck First Bar Light Station bears N. 21° E (Magnetic) distant 683 feet.
The wreck is marked by a native boat exhibiting from sunset to sunrise 2 red unclassed lights, suspended vertically, 3 feet apart. By day a red flag is exhibited.
The wreck marking boat is moored over the top of the wreck and can be passed on either side.
